But does it alert you via text when an ADR time slot opens up ?

The Touring Plans service SENDS you a text if it finds an ADR time slot you want when it checks. That does not mean you will RECEIVE the text when the ADR time slot opens up. I tried it, and the text came through to me 4 hours after it was sent. I sent an email inquiring about the time lag, and they told me this happens with texts and I should google it.

Also keep in mind that it does not check constantly. Perhaps it searches every 20 minutes, or 15, or 25. I don't know exactly. But it is not always searching. So ADRs can open up and be filled while it is not searching for you. If you set up a search on the Touring Plans website, you can look at it and see when it last searched for you.

When I searched on my own, I saw two Be Our Guest ADR slots for lunch and 2 for dinner during the days I would be there. The only one the service found for me was the one for which the text arrived 4 hours late, and of course the ADR was gone by that time.

Lags with notices from texts are not a TP problem, unfortunately. Nothing they can do for your provider to get the text to you correctly, all they can do is send it out, which it does. Luckily I think this is a rare issue
Also worth noting that it does not book it for you or lock it down until you get there. You have to beat others to it and you can almost assure that if it's hard to get there are others looking too. So you gotta be fast.
The one drawback to TP is if it alerts you and you don't book it, or if you want it to keep looking for some reason, you have to restart the search. When it sends you an alert, it stops the search. This is important to remember if you miss the ADR
